JupyterNotebook:在进行中的数据项目清单汇总

需积分: 5 0 下载量 15 浏览量 更新于2024-12-25 收藏 556KB ZIP 举报
资源摘要信息:"Misc-Projects:项目清单(进行中)" 1. Jupyter Notebook的基本介绍 Jupyter Notebook是一款开源的Web应用程序,允许创建和共享包含代码、方程、可视化和解释性文本的文档。它支持多种编程语言,最常用的是Python。Jupyter Notebook非常适合数据清洗与转换、统计建模、数据可视化、机器学习等数据科学相关领域。 2. 数据项目的执行与管理 在数据项目中,"项目清单"是指列出当前正在进行的所有项目以及这些项目所处的状态和进度。这是项目管理中的重要环节,它能够帮助团队跟踪项目进展,确保资源的合理分配,同时为项目决策提供数据支持。 3. 数据科学项目的生命周期 数据科学项目的生命周期通常包括以下几个阶段: - 项目准备:确定项目的目标、范围和资源; - 数据收集:收集原始数据,通常来源于数据库、API、文件等; - 数据清洗:清理数据中的缺失值、异常值,去除重复项等; - 数据探索:通过统计分析和可视化了解数据特征; - 特征工程:根据数据和项目需求选择、构造合适的特征; - 模型构建:使用机器学习算法构建模型; - 模型训练与测试:对模型进行训练,并在测试集上评估其性能; - 结果部署:将模型部署到生产环境中; - 维护与监控:持续监控模型表现,根据需要进行调优和维护。 4. Jupyter Notebook在数据项目中的应用 Jupyter Notebook在数据项目中的应用十分广泛。开发者可以在Notebook中直接编写代码,进行实验性编程,并实时查看代码的输出。这使得数据分析过程更加迭代和交互式,非常适合进行数据探索和模型原型设计。此外,Notebook可以导出为多种格式,如HTML、PDF、Python脚本,方便分享和汇报。 5. 数据项目清单的重要性 数据项目清单(进行中)是项目管理的重要组成部分。通过项目清单,项目管理者可以快速掌握当前所有项目的进度和状态,以及每个项目的优先级和资源分配情况。这对于项目的时间管理和风险控制至关重要。 6. Jupyter Notebook的扩展功能和插件 Jupyter Notebook提供了强大的插件系统,允许用户根据自己的需求扩展其功能。例如,可以安装插件来提升数据可视化的能力,或者增强代码编辑和交互的便捷性。这些插件能够帮助用户更高效地完成数据科学工作。 7. 数据项目管理和协作工具 在进行数据项目时,团队成员间的协作是非常重要的。Jupyter Notebook支持多用户实时编辑同一个Notebook,还能够集成版本控制系统如Git,方便团队成员间的代码合并、版本控制和协作。同时,还有其他的协作工具如Databricks、Google Colab等,它们提供了云端的Notebook服务,支持多人协作和大规模计算。 总结来说,Misc-Projects项目清单中所包含的数据项目在进行中,涉及到使用Jupyter Notebook这一强大的工具,以及遵循数据项目生命周期的各阶段进行管理和执行。清单的编制有助于项目管理者对项目的实时监控和资源的合理分配,确保项目的顺利进行。同时,团队成员可以通过Jupyter Notebook及其丰富的插件和协作工具,提高工作效率,实现数据项目的目标。